Background:
ERK1, a member of the MAP kinase subfamily of Ser/Thr protein kinases, is involved in both the initiation and regulation of meiosis, mitosis, and postmitotic functions in differentiated cells by phosphorylating a number of transcription factors such as ELK-1. It phosphorylates EIF4EBP1 and is required for initiation of translation. The protein also phosphorylates microtubule-associated protein-2 (MAP2). ERK1 is activated and tyrosine phosphorylated in response to insulin and NGF.
